What Product Management and Development contributes to Cardinal Health
Marketing is responsible for assessing customer needs, market conditions and competition to inform business strategy. Marketing implements the strategy through developing, commercializing and monitoring the appropriate products and services.
Product Management and Development is responsible for researching, developing, and launching new products for the company. Responds to company initiatives by driving new products to meet customer needs.
Job Summary
The Product Manager, Product Management & Development develops product marketing strategies and manages product development to differentiate Cardinal Health’s products and to grow revenue, market share, and customer awareness. In line with the broader commercial strategy and the Marketing strategy set by the Director, the Product Manager manages the research, business cases, development, and launches of products in a portfolio. This job works with a large degree of independence.
